Output 39ec941dd0ccb5b2d97a2e249b112cd68350b335cb08c4fbfc58dd1ee19ebb8d:3

value
524436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d047ebf1350a5a7cdb2b65dffb46f68ba762b0e OP_EQUAL
address
3EYeav9K3pN19XRV62xqzLC3pLc3oSw4c3
transaction
39ec941dd0ccb5b2d97a2e249b112cd68350b335cb08c4fbfc58dd1ee19ebb8d
confirmations
86433
spent
true